HOW THESE SYSTEMS DECIDE

Why AI Skips Your Company

Language models do not rank pages the way Google traditionally did, and septic contractors get left out for predictable reasons. They assemble an answer from sources they consider clear, consistent, and corroborated. Septic companies get left out for predictable reasons.

  • Nothing on your site answers a question. AI systems pull passages that directly answer what was asked. A page that says “we offer quality septic services with over 20 years of experience” answers nothing and gets quoted nowhere.
  • Your business details contradict each other. Different hours on your site than your profile, an old phone number in a directory, an inconsistent service area. When sources disagree, these systems resolve the conflict by using somebody else.
  • No structured data. Schema markup tells machines exactly what you do, where, and for whom. Without it they are guessing from prose.
  • Thin review presence. Reviews are heavily weighted corroboration. A company with 14 reviews and one with 180 are not treated as equally real.
  • You exist in only one place. These systems favor businesses that are described consistently across your site, your profile, directories, and third-party mentions. One website and nothing else is a weak signal.
  • Your crawler access is blocked or broken. Some sites unintentionally block the crawlers these tools rely on, or render content in a way they cannot read.

THE APPROACH

How We Get You Cited

Make the answer easy to find, easy to verify, and impossible to contradict.

We restructure your content so it answers the questions people actually ask out loud: how much does it cost to pump a septic tank, how do I know if my drain field is failing, who does septic inspections for a home sale in my county. Direct answers first, detail after. That passage structure is what gets quoted.

Then we make you consistent. Name, address, phone, hours, service area, and service list identical across your website, your Google Business Profile, and every directory that matters. Contradiction is the fastest way to get skipped.

On top of that we add proper schema markup, build the review corroboration these systems lean on, and pursue the third-party mentions that make your business look real from more than one angle. Then we check what the assistants actually say about your market and adjust.
